| Sumario: | "We report experimental results obtained with a circuit possessing dynamic logic architecture based on one of the theoretical schemes proposed by H. Peng and collaborators in 2008. The schematic diagram of the electronic circuit and its implementation to get different basic logic gates are displayed and discussed. In particular, we show explicitly how to get the electronic NOR, NAND and XOR gates. The proposed electronic circuit is easy to build because it employs only resistors, operational amplifiers and comparators." |
